    Suppose you have started Receiver communictaion channel , when ever Adapter engine receive the message then JDBC adapter
    will deliver the message to Data base, if data base connection failed due to some reason like Network issue or Data base down, in this case Receiver adapter tries min 3 times to deliver data to Data base, after that it will give error message.
    You can set number retries and time interface by your self.

    Dear ,
    Please follwo the below steps for running forecast for Constant Model :
    In MM02  you should maintain the following paramters :
    1.MRP1-MRP4 view : MRP Type -VV, Planned delivery Time , Lot Size-EX  , Servicelevel Percentage -80-90% , Plannnig Startegey -10/20  as applicable , Procurement Type -F/E/X as apalicable , Period Indicator-M etc .
    2.In forcasting view , Please maintain the following :
    1.Forecast Model -D (Constant Model)  2.Period Indicator-M (flolows from MRP views) , Histry Period-10 ,Forecast Period -2/3 (How many months u want the system to forecast ) ,Period per sesson -10
    In Control Data : Initialisation -X , Model Selection -A , Traking Limit -4 , Reset Automatically -Marked  ,Optimisation Level -F
    Now , if you enter  the  smoothing factor : Alpha , beta , Gama and Delta each 0.30  , hit enter , it will re-set Appha 0.1-0.05 and Delta  0.30  because this two is applicable for Cosntant Model
    Finally save this  and execute Forecasting through single material in MM02-Forecasting View -Exectute Forecast Option  or Collectively total forcast thropugh MP38 .Result will be Foercast Qty , basic Values , MAD , Safet stock .

  • How to find the time taken for creating execution plan alone

    Hi,
    Is there any way to find out the division between the time taken for query parsing, creating execution plan and actual data retrieval seperately? If I enable 'set timing on' I see the elapsed time which is the total time taken for all these 3.
    Some of my queries are taking long time when I run it first time and so want to know what is it taking long, is it the parsing the query or creating the execution plan? (Since my queries run faster second time, I am assuming the major part was for parsing or creating the plan but not the data retrieval).
    Also, where does Oracle keep the execution plan? Is it in the BUFFER_CACHE? if so, I tried flushing the buffer_cache and restarting the DB as well, but still the query execution seems faster compared to the first time. How long does Oracle keep the execution plan in the cache and is there anyway to increase this cache size?
    Thanks in advance!

    user13169027 wrote:
    Hi,
    Is there any way to find out the division between the time taken for query parsing, creating execution plan and actual data retrieval seperately? If I enable 'set timing on' I see the elapsed time which is the total time taken for all these 3.
    Some of my queries are taking long time when I run it first time and so want to know what is it taking long, is it the parsing the query or creating the execution plan? (Since my queries run faster second time, I am assuming the major part was for parsing or creating the plan but not the data retrieval).
    The ideal way for finding the answer to your questions above, would be to perform a (sql) trace of your query executions. To see the difference in the trace-files, you might want to trace the first execution in one session, and the second execution in another session: so you get two different trace files, which you can then seperately tkprof, and investigate.
    Also, where does Oracle keep the execution plan? Is it in the BUFFER_CACHE? if so, I tried flushing the buffer_cache and restarting the DB as well, but still the query execution seems faster compared to the first time. How long does Oracle keep the execution plan in the cache and is there anyway to increase this cache size?
    Execution plans are held in the shared-pool, not the buffer-cache. As far as I know they will be kept in memory in an LRU way (least recently used), just like db-blocks are in the buffer-pool (I know this is not entirely correct, but for all practical purposes, think of it this way).
